FP7-PEOPLE-2010: Individual Fellowships open!
The Individual Fellowships provide a financial support to experienced researchers to carry out research and acquire new skills and knowledge. Conditio sine qua non: Mobility! I.e. Researchers have to move from one country to another. As for the other Marie Curie Actions, the Individual Fellowships follow a bottom-up approach, i.e. the research topic is chosen freely by the applicant, in liaison with the host institution.

5th Global South Workshop, 4-8 October 2010
Call for Participation: 5th Global South Workshop at Graduate Institute of International and Development Studies, Geneva.
The Graduate Institute of International and Development Studies is a world renowned graduate school of teaching and research in these fields. It was created in 2008 by the merger of the Graduate Institute of International Studies, Europe's first institutes of international studies (founded 1927), and the Graduate Institute of Development Studies, one of Europe's first institutes devoted to the study of development (founded 1961). The Institute plays host to a diversified and vibrant body of students and faculty.

First Swiss satellite launched into space!
Satish Dhawan Space Center SwissCube (Source: http://isi.hevs.ch)
SwissCube, the first Swiss satellite was launched into space on 23 September 2009 at 11:51 local time from Satish Dhawan Space Centre, India. SwissCube travelled on board the Indian PSLV (Polar Satellite Launch Vehicle) together with 5 other nano satellites from Germany and Turkey. The pico satellite SwissCube (1kg, 10cm x 10cm x 10cm) is the first entirely-built Swiss satellite.
This endeavor is led by the EPFL Space Center in Switzerland in collaboration with several Swiss universities since 2006.
The scientific objective of the SwissCube is to study the airglow phenomena, a photoluminescence of the atmosphere occurring at approximately 100km altitude. The mission of SwissCube will last between 3 and 12 months.

Indo Swiss Public Private Partnership Pilot Programme (Indo Swiss PPP Pilot Programme)
The "Indo Swiss PPP Pilot Programme" is a new funding scheme providing support for market-oriented R&D projects involving Swiss and Indian partners. The main goal of this program is to promote innovation in Switzerland and India. The "Indo Swiss PPP Pilot Programme" is implemented in Switzerland by the Innovation Promotion Agency (CTI) together with EPFL.

12-13 October 2009
It is with the greatest regret that EPFL has to announce the postponement of the Indo-Swiss Symposium, initially scheduled on October 12th and 13th, 2009 at the EPFL.
EPFL has just been informed by the Department of Science & Technology that following the severe drought and the subsequent emergency measures taken by the Government of India, the Indian partners have not received the authorization to travel to Switzerland. Therefore, EPFL has been asked to postpone the Symposium to a later date.
